refactor(coding-agent): fix compaction for branched sessions, consolidate hook context types

Compaction API:
- prepareCompaction() now takes (pathEntries, settings) only
- CompactionPreparation restructured: removed cutPoint/messagesToKeep/boundaryStart, added turnPrefixMessages/isSplitTurn/previousSummary/fileOps/settings
- compact() now takes (preparation, model, apiKey, customInstructions?, signal?)
- Fixed token overflow by using getPath() instead of getEntries()

Hook types:
- HookEventContext renamed to HookContext
- HookCommandContext removed, RegisteredCommand.handler takes (args, ctx)
- HookContext now includes model field
- SessionBeforeCompactEvent: removed previousCompactions/model, added branchEntries
- SessionBeforeTreeEvent: removed model (use ctx.model)
- HookRunner.initialize() added for modes to set up callbacks
